Job Description:
Job Description Summary The Licensed Social Worker (LISW),
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) or Licensed Professional
Counselor-Associate (LPC-A) reports to the Division Director.
Provide a wide variety of direct therapeutic social worker services
in an outpatient psychiatric setting for a complex caseload of
patients including psychosocial assessment, active treatment, case
management, and related documentation in collaboration with a
multi-disciplinary treatment team. Entity University Medical

Salary/Exempt Job Duties and Responsibilities: Provides individual
and group therapy to adult and adolescent patients in an outpatient
general psychiatry treatment clinic located within an academic
medical center. Interviews client, family and any other providers
to assess the patient's level of functioning, strengths and
deficits, and emotional status. Develops a comprehensive picture of
the client's service and treatment needs. Serves as a member of the
treatment team in the diagnostic evaluation of clients and the
identification of treatment objectives. Education: Licensed Social
Worker (LISW): Master's Degree in Social Work or Social Welfare
program accredited by the Council on Social Work Education
required.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C): Master's Degree in
Counseling or related field for LPC from an accredited program.
Licensed Professional Counselor-Associate (LPC-A): Master's Degree
in Counseling or related field for LPC-A from an accredited
program. Required Work Experience: At least four years of relevant
work experience. Required Licensure, Certifications, Registrations:
Master’s degree in a social work or social welfare program
accredited by the Council on Social Work Education or from a social
work program or social welfare program offered by a regionally
accredited institution. Degree of Supervision: LISW/LPC/LPC-A will
be assigned a Primary Supervising/Collaborating Physician employed
by MUSC and will report directly to this physician. Physical
